So, last night as we were driving out to Kridz, for some reason, we had the radio on. We were listening to eXtra 92.1. It turns out, at that exact moment, they were talking about beer.
So, I did some research, and it seems every Thursday around 5:15ish, 92.1 has a program about beer; entitled "Extra on Tap". The DJ during that segment is "Just Plain Tim". The beer expert is Aaron Young, who is a bartender at JT Walker's Restaurant & Sports Bar in Mahomet.

CU Bars in the News; JT Walkers
JT Walkers in Mahomet was featured on Channel 3 (WCIA) on Thursday.
JT Walkers on WCIA
I haven't been there, but I've heard good things about them.
Mahomet used to be dry, but it's not anymore.
The beer list looks pretty good (for a small town). The taps could use some work (11 taps), but there is listed Bell's seasonal, Leinenkugel seasonal, and Sam Adams seasonal.
Bottles include Most of the Big Sky line; Leinenkugels, New Belgiums, Bell's (4 Bell's) and some Schlafly's. Goose Island Matilda is also on the menu, as is Lindeman's Framboise.
I've heard good things about the food. I'll be checking this place out sometime in the near future.
